On 2/23/21 9:56 AM, Decabytes wrote:
> I've been playing around in D for a bit and I'm enjoying it so far. I've
> also been testing out freebsd on a Raspberry Pi 3. I noticed that there
> is actually a package for LDC on the raspberry pi 3, and thought it
> would be fun to play around with D on an ARM platform.
>
> I installed it with "pkg install ldc", but embarrassingly I'm not
> actually sure where the compiler is. ldc isn't a recognized action on
> the command line, and I've hunted around my /usr/local/llvm10/ directory
> but I'm having difficulty finding anything that looks like what I'm
> looking for. Does anyone have any experience with ldc on freebsd that
> could help me out?
Found this on the internet:
https://forums.freebsd.org/threads/list-of-the-installed-files-of-a-package.66372/
looks like:
pkg info -l name-of-package
It should show you were it put the ldc command and what it's called.
